Sew4Service, in partnership with the Cuyahoga County Library Warrensville Heights Branch, has assembled a talented group of artists, quilters, stitchers, and textile specialists. They will share their expertise through 11 demonstrations and over 8 hands-on workshops. In addition, library staff will demonstrate how the tools and technologies available in their Innovation Center can assist attendees in bringing their creative ideas to life. Participants can customize their experience by selecting which sessions they want to attend during registration.

You won’t want to miss the demo with Dru Christine, a Cleveland-based fashion designer and entrepreneur. Her session, Upcycle Smart: Turning Everyday Garments into Wearable Pieces without Starting from Scratch, offers a thoughtful perspective on upcycling that emphasizes skill, intention, and design over fleeting trends.
